| Title | FIP-fve stimulates cell proliferation and enhances IL-2 release by activating MAP2K3/p38α(MAPK14)signaling pathway in Jurkat E6-1 cells |
| Description | FIP-fve, a fungal fruiting body protein from Flammulina velutipes, has potential immunomodulatory properties. Here, we investigated the immunomodulation mechanism of FIP-fve in Jurkat E6-1 cells by conducting cell viability assay and IL-2 release assay. Kinase inhibitors experiment and proteomics analysis were also involved in the mechanism study. It was found that FIP-fve stimulated cell proliferation and enhanced IL-2 secretion in a dose-dependent manner in Jurkat E6-1 cells. Unbiased high-throughput proteomics analysis showed that 4 T cell immune activation markers including ZAP-70, CD69, CD82 and KIF23 were upregulated in response to FIP-fve treatment. Further pathway analysis indicated that MAP2K3/p38 pathway related proteins including MAP2K, p38, ELK, AATF, FOS, and JUN-B were unregulated. In addition, losmapimod (p38 inhibitor) and gossypetin (MAP2K3 inhibitor) inhibited FIP-fve enhanced cell proliferation and IL-2 release in Jurkat E6-1 cells. Our results demonstrate that FIP-fve stimulates cell proliferation and enhances IL-2 secretion through MAP2K3/ p38α activation. |
